About Melania Gaggini
Melania Gaggini is a scholar working on Endocrinology, Diabetes and Metabolism, Epidemiology and Physiology, having authored 83 papers that have together received 3.9k indexed citations. Recurring topics across this work include Liver Disease Diagnosis and Treatment (38 papers), Diet, Metabolism, and Disease (18 papers) and Diet and metabolism studies (10 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(1.3k citations), Epidemiology (2.2k citations) and Hepatology (433 citations). Melania Gaggini has collaborated with scholars based in Italy, United States and Sweden. Frequent co-authors include Amalia Gastaldelli, Ralph A. DeFronzo, Fabrizia Carli, Chiara Saponaro, Elisabetta Bugianesi, E. Buzzigoli, Mariangela Morelli, Cristina Vassalle, Chiara Rosso and Maria Lorena Abate. Their work appears in journals such as PLoS ONE, Hepatology and The Journal of Clinical Endocrinology & Metabolism.
